On July 25, 2022 at approximately 4am, officers of the Hope Police Department received a call in reference to shots fired into a dwelling located in the 2000 block of West Avenue E, in Hope, Arkansas.

Upon arrival officers were notified that the occupants of the home were awakened by gunfire from outside of the residence and that a person inside the residence had been shot. Officers entered the residence and located Marcela Lopez, 40, of Hope, with a gunshot wound to her upper torso laying unresponsive on the floor. A family member was attempting to render aid. Officers assisted with rendering aid until Pafford EMS and Hope Fire arrived on scene and began providing medical assistance. Mrs. Lopez was transported to Wadley hospital where she was later pronounced deceased.

Investigators believe a 4-door vehicle, possibly a Dodge Charger, was in the street near the residence at this time of the shooting.
No arrests have been made at this time. If anyone has any information about this incident please call 911 or Sergeant Todd Lauterbach at 870-722-2576.
This investigation is ongoing.
